#4e9d8d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e9d8d is composed of 30.6% red, 61.6%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 10.2%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 167.8 degrees, a saturation of 33.6% and a lightness of 46.1%. #4e9d8d color hex could be obtained by blending #9cffff with #003b1b.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#4e9d8d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4e9d8d has RGB values of R:78, G:157,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.1,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 5152141.

Shades and Tints of #4e9d8d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060d0c is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e9d8d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#727977 is the less saturated color, while #06e5b8 is the most saturated one.
